Last week I bought engine GA000099 from Freezing914 in the hopes of picking up some spare parts to support rebuild of the engine that came with my vehicle.
During the teardown of my vehicles engine, it is quickly becoming clear that the engine was abused by some DAPO. Cooling flaps and thermostat had been removed. Rust in the sump. The crank was scored and already 0.010" undersized. The oil pump was torn up. This is just the tip of the iceberg on the engine that came with my vehicle. (IMG:style_emoticons/default/chair.gif) 14 hours of driving seems to have netted me an engine that might be worthy of a rebuild. (IMG:style_emoticons/default/piratenanner.gif) This engine appears to be bone stock. D-jet mostly complete. As an added bonus I discovered upon teardown that none of the cooling tin fasteners have ever been disturbed. No screwdriver marks! But . . . like any engine of this age and unknown origin, it absolutely needs to be gone though. |

As an added bonus, this engine came complete with FI and as it turns out the Aux Air Regulator actually works. How cool is that!
![]() Did a light cleaning and lube with some WD-40 and it is good to go! Likewise the injectors that came from the engine were handed off to Bill Johnson at Mr. Injector. Mr Injector is out in Hayden Lake Idaho. I lived out in that area back in the 80's. I stopped into the shop to drop off the injectors when I was in Idaho on vacation. What a great guy. Bill has been out in Idaho since the Late 50's. We talked about how much the area has changed over the years as the population continues to grow. Bill is the real deal - a real car guy. Not many left in this world. So thrilled to be able to do business with him face to face. He previously did another batch of injectors for me. Out of that batch of 7 unfortunately we only saved 4. The great thing about Mr. Injector is that if he can't get them working and flowing properly - No charge. This batch was another story. All 4 were working and all 4 flow great now. ![]() I actually have a total of 12 injectors at this point to go with 2 engines. Ultimately a set will go up on classifieds once I know I have my engines covered and running. |
